Industry: Email Alert RSS FeedShoney's 3rd-Q net rises 8 percent
Nation's Restaurant News, Sept 27, 1993
NASHVILLE, Tenn. -- Lower interest payments and improved same-store sales led to an 8-percent third-quarter increase over year-ago net income for Shoney's Inc.
The company said earnings climbed to $16.6 million, on a 6-percent increase in revenues, to $274.1 million, for the quarter ended Aug. 11.
Same-store sales during the period rose 0.6 percent, contrasted with a 3.1-percent decline in the second quarter.
The company said it is also benefiting from lower interest rates and principal payments on its bank borrowings. A year ago the company paid $11.7 million in interest expenses, compared with $10 million for the period just ended.
"We are pleased with the improvement in comparable-store sales during the third quarter compared to the second quarter," said Taylor H. Henry, chairman and chief executive officer. "We will continue to focus on the remodeling of restaurants, additional management training and the implementation of a new menu for the Shoney's concept. We expect continued improvement in sales and earnings in the fourth quarter."
